現在python前途如何?

大白今天吃了嗎


Python具有豐富和強大的庫。它常被暱稱為膠水語言,能夠把用其他語言製作的各種模塊(尤其是C/C++)很輕鬆地聯結在一起。Python 可以做任何事情。無論是從入門級選手到專業級數據挖掘、科學計算、圖像處理、人工智能,Python 都可以勝任。或許是因為這種萬能屬性,周圍好更多的小夥伴都開始學習 Python。

Python 是一門新手友好、功能強大、高效靈活的編程語言,學會之後無論是想進入數據分析、人工智能、網站開發這些領域,還是希望掌握第一門編程語言,都可以用 Python 來開啟無限未來的無限可能!

Python可以做什麼?

在編程語言中, Python長期穩居前五,不僅已經成為數據分析、人工智能領域必不可少的工具,還被越來越多地公司用於網站搭建。基本上可以負責任地認為,Python 可以做任何事情。無論是從入門級選手到專業級數據挖掘、科學計算、圖像處理、人工智能,Python 都可以勝任。

Python 方向崗位的薪水在水漲船高,成為目前最有潛力的編程語言之一。

Python爆紅的原因是什麼?

Python 的語言排名也是節節升高!

Python 被譽為最好人工智能的語言,因為:

l 在數據科學和 AI 中佔據主導地位;

l 擁有優質的文檔和豐富的庫,對於科學用途的廣泛編程任務都很有用;

l 設計非常好,快速,堅固,可移植,可擴展;

l 開源,而且擁有一個健康、活躍、支持度高的社區;

l 有一些很棒的公司贊助商,YouTube、谷歌、Yahoo!、NASA 都在內部大量地使用


PHP開發工程師


Python應用場景

  Web應用開發

  Python經常被用於Web開發。比如,通過mod_wsgi模塊,Apache可以運行用Python編寫的Web程序。Python定義了WSGI標準應用接口來協調Http服務器與基於Python的Web程序之間的通信。一些Web框架,如Django,TurboGears,web2py,Zope等,可以讓程序員輕鬆地開發和管理複雜的Web程序。

  操作系統管理、服務器運維的自動化腳本

  在很多操作系統裡,Python是標準的系統組件。大多數Linux發行版以及NetBSD、OpenBSD和MacOSX都集成了Python,可以在終端下直接運行Python。有一些Linux發行版的安裝器使用Python語言編寫,比如Ubuntu的Ubiquity安裝器,RedHatLinux和Fedora的Anaconda安裝器。GentooLinux使用Python來編寫它的Portage包管理系統。Python標準庫包含了多個調用操作系統功能的庫。通過pywin32這個第三方軟件包,Python能夠訪問Windows的COM服務及其它WindowsAPI。使用IronPython,Python程序能夠直接調用.NetFramework。一般說來,Python編寫的系統管理腳本在可讀性、性能、代碼重用度、擴展性幾方面都優於普通的shell腳本。

  科學計算

  NumPy,SciPy,Matplotlib可以讓Python程序員編寫科學計算程序。

  桌面軟件

  PyQt、PySide、wxPython、PyGTK是Python快速開發桌面應用程序的利器。

  服務器軟件(網絡軟件)

  Python對於各種網絡協議的支持很完善,因此經常被用於編寫服務器軟件、網絡爬蟲。第三方庫Twisted支持異步網絡編程和多數標準的網絡協議(包含客戶端和服務器),並且提供了多種工具,被廣泛用於編寫高性能的服務器軟件。

  遊戲

  很多遊戲使用C++編寫圖形顯示等高性能模塊,而使用Python或者Lua編寫遊戲的邏輯、服務器。相較於Python,Lua的功能更簡單、體積更小;而Python則支持更多的特性和數據類型。

  構思實現,產品早期原型和迭代

  YouTube、Google、Yahoo!、NASA都在內部大量地使用Python。


zhruanjian


什麼學好了都不白學


曉飛2000


Python是一種通用的編程語言,可以在任何現代計算機操作系統上使用。它可以用來處理文本、數字、圖像、科學數據以及任何你可能保存在計算機上的東西。

1、學習完Python之後能做什麼呢?

近年來,Python因為簡單易學、功能強大成為最近大火的編程語言,大家在學習的過程中,也不可避免會想到學習完Python之後能做些什麼呢?Python語言能做到的東西還是超級多的,像大家都比較熟悉的爬蟲、web應用開發、人工智能、數據分析等等,Python都可以輕鬆完成。也正是因為Python語言自身的這種兼容性,也讓更多的小夥伴們選擇學習Python語言。

2、學習Python會不會有前途?

瞭解完Python能做什麼之後,大家還會關心一下學習Python會不會有前途,首先從國家培養人才方向上來講,《新一代人工智能發展規劃》中,人工智能正式納入國家發展戰略,並且已經有數個省份將Python納入到高考體系,國家計算機二級考試新增 “ Python 語言程序設計”科目。這些都直接證明了Python的發展前景十分廣闊。

其次再說一下Python人才的供需情況,隨著最近五年Python的持續走熱,越來越多的公司開始使用Python編程語言。具體情況大家可以看一下各個招聘平臺的具體數據,智聯每日在招Python職位:34504個,前程無憂每日在招Python職位:40456個,人才缺口巨大,需求量在不斷增長,並且薪資水平也是十分可觀。

3、學習Python有哪些注意事項?

從以上這些數據資料大家可以瞭解到Python的前景非常好,也因此有越來越多的人想要從事相關崗位,然而目前招聘市場上很多所謂的Python開發工程師並不能真正滿足企業的實際用人需求。一知半解的人並不缺,缺少的是真正掌握Python實操技術的人。

如果大家真的想要從事這個行業,那一定要從基礎進行學習,不要急於求成或者迷信論壇中“有些人學了半天就完全掌握了”這樣的言論。如有真的有人能半天就完全掌握Python,一定是本身有很深厚的開發語言基礎。只需要瞭解一下Python語言的語法就可以,如果大家是剛剛接觸Python,還是需要先把基礎打牢。


feimao413


百戰程序員2018年Python高速崛起首批開設Python課程,Python課程作為人工智能最簡編程語言,一度成為編程第一語言,可以說就目前形式看,前途非常好,相信短時間內會成為各企業最新賴的語言之一


小小程序員玲兒


很高興回答這個問題!

python從1991年發佈第一個版本到現在已經快三十年了,它真正走進廣大程序員的視野,也就是近十年的事情,作為高級語言,它相較於C語言、C++語言、甚至JAVA都要更加簡單易懂。

人生苦短,我用python

python語言開發起來是非常高效的,他有非常強大的第三方類庫,程序員可以在這些類庫的基礎上再開發,極大的縮短了開發週期。


這些類庫是需要逐漸積累的,這也就是python為什麼沒有一發布就非常火爆的原因,如今的python開發,是站在前人的肩膀上,利用前人開發好的工具,就可以快速完成開發項目。

所以it界有句話,人生苦短,我用python!

python有多火

在知名技術交流網站Stack Overflow在2019年年初推出的開發人員調查報告中,有四分之一的開發者表示,Python是他們最想學習的編程語言,這也是Python連續三年獲得這個榜單的第一名。


Python是目前IT就業市場最受歡迎,最熱門的技術技能之一,無論是初學者還是技術大牛,python都是非常好的一個選擇。

python的未來

如今python可實現的功能非常多,它可以用來搭建網站,做網絡爬蟲,也可以用來做數據挖掘。在當前大數據、人工智能當道的時代,python就是個順應時代的寵兒,所以只要大數據和人工智能還處在不斷挖掘的階段,python就會表現出強大的生命力。

python已經逐漸超越java成為第一編程語言,估計在未來十年內,python都處在金字塔頂端。


一把勺子


作為一名IT行業的從業者,同時也是一名教育工作者,我來回答一下這個問題。

上升趨勢

首先,Python語言目前的上升趨勢非常明顯,由於Python語言簡單易學,而且Python語言的應用場景也非常多,所以目前越來越多的普通職場人開始學習Python語言。實際上,隨著大數據、人工智能等技術的落地應用,未來掌握Python語言將為職場人帶來更多的便利,掌握Python語言也會在一定程度上促進職場人的崗位升級。

產業發展趨勢

從當前產業互聯網的發展趨勢,以及產業結構升級的大背景來看,未來Python不僅會在IT行業內廣泛使用,在傳統行業內也將成為一個重要的工具。實際上,任何編程語言的流行都有明顯的時代特徵,在當前的大數據、人工智能時代,Python語言將有廣闊的應用空間,所以未來大數據和人工智能走到哪裡,Python語言就會跟到哪裡。

應用情況

從目前傳統行業對於Python語言的應用情況來看,主要有三種應用方式,其一是基於Python來完成專業的數據分析;其二是基於Python來完成日常工作任務的處理;其三是基於Python來提升工作效率。與IT行業不同,在傳統行業內,很多業務平臺,包括智能化的辦公系統,對於Python進行了進一步的簡化,使得職場人在使用Python的時候更簡單,這也在一定程度上促進了Python語言的應用。


皇德華叫獸


一片光明,已逐步成為編程界二哥


四方源9527


應該還可以吧!網傳萬能的工具,學得專業點可以找好工作,業餘的也能提高自己的技術水平,學好了,幹什麼都能快人一籌。

不過python有好幾個發展方向,需選擇自己需要的,愛好的去學,否則會浪費很多時間!

我現在也是剛和他打交道,好多東西還在學習摸索中,希望樓下的回答能更全面些!

一句話,如果想學,就得下功夫,需要大量的時間。最後還是把我瞭解到的幾大方向說一說:1.數據挖掘2.web編程3.數據分析4.運維及自動化交易等等!

第三點是最難的,需要掌握很多知識,而且需要高數基礎,學習的時間也最長。

所以,還得看自己的能力。好多人都沒能堅持下去,但好多人說:人生苦短,我只學python!

python能在短時間風靡全球,一定有他的好處,這點毋庸置疑,至於好在哪裡?這個需要你自己去發現了!


東風破805


直接這麼跟你說吧!Python雖然學習起來容易上手,但公司需要的是你會很多算法,智商很高邏輯的應用他們,所以一般只有高學歷和高智商人才才會被應聘。


分享到:


相關文章: